The purpose of this form is to provide an exact an common format for the form header, which is the first record of a file containing actual MONICA data in the magnetic tape or diskette in which data are transferred from the MONICA Collaborating Centre (MCC) to the MONICA Data Centre (MDC). The automatic data processing routine of the MDC uses the information of the FORM HEADER to find out what kind of data to expect in the file and to check that the data found corresponds to the data expected. Thus it is important that the FORM HEADER is recorded correctly.
The ITEM NAME on the form is a computer variable name used for the item by the MDC. The COLUMNS indicate the columns on which the value of the item is to appear in the record on the magnetic tape or diskette.
None of the characters of the form should be left blank.
These instructions should be followed carefully when the FORM HEADER is created. Please ensure that the instructions are for the version of the FORM HEADER format being used. Specific instructions are listed by item below:
| 1 | FORM | Form identification | |_H|_D|_R|_F|_O|_R|_M|_S| | 1 to 8 |
Enter "HDRFORMS" to indicate the FORM HEADER.
| 2 | VERSN | Form version | |_3| | 9 |
Enter the version number printed on the FORM HEADER form. If the number is not 3 these instructions do not correspond to the form version you are using. Check that you are using the valid version of the form.
| 3 | HDFORM | Form identification of the following forms | |__|__| | 10 to 11 |
Enter here the form identification of the data forms for which actual MONICA data is included in this file. The accepted values here are 01, 02,..., where 01 means the CORE DATA TRANSFER FORMAT - CORONARY EVENTS etc.
| 4 | HDVERSN | Form version of the following forms | |__| | 12 |
Enter here the form version of the data forms for which actual MONICA data is included in this file.
| 5 | HDCENTRE | MONICA Collaborating Centre code | |__|__| | 13 to 14 |
Enter the official MONICA Collaborating Centre code number as it appears in Part I, Appendix 2: MONICA Collaborating Centres and Reporting Units.
| 6 | HDRUNIT | MONICA Reporting Unit code | |__|__| | 15 to 16 |
Enter the official MONICA Reporting Unit code number of the Reporting Unit for which data are submitted in this file.
| 7 | HDNUMSUR | Number of the MONICA Population Survey | |__| | 17 |
If HDFORM has value 04, 05 or 08 (i.e. if survey data are submitted in this file) enter here the number of the MONICA Population Survey which the data comes from. If the data in this file is not survey data, in other words if HDFORM is 01, 02, 03, 06 or 07, code here 8.
| 8 | HDNUMFOR | Number of forms of type HDFORM in this file | |__|__|__|__|__| | 18 to 22 |
Enter the number of forms (excluding the FORM HEADER and FORM TRAILER) for which data are submitted in this file. Note that the number of records is not asked here. If you divide the forms into two records the number of records will be much larger than the number of forms.
| 9 | RECSPF | Number of records per form in this file | |__| | 23 |
If you use records long enough to contain all data of a form, code here 1. If you have to split the form into two records code 2 for this item. If you split forms into several records please contact the MONICA Data Centre for instructions.
Every form (excluding the FORM HEADER and FORM TRAILER) of a Data File must have the same number of records per form.
An example of a FORM HEADER as it is listed from a computer record is given below:
HDRFORMS304316011018521
